Verb

edit

أَذْعَنَ (ʔaḏʕana) IV, non-past يُذْعِنُ‎ (yuḏʕinu)

  1. (intransitive) to yield, to submit, to give in [with لِ (li) ‘to someone/something’]
    أَذْعَنَ لِمَطَالِبِهِمʔaḏʕana limaṭālibihimHe gave in to their demands.
